How to Compress an AVI to DVD

    Free DVD Video Studio AVI Converter

    • 1). Download and install the AVI compression tool from the Freemake website. Double-click the desktop icon to run the software.

    • 2). Click "+Video" in the upper left corner of the control panel. Locate your AVI video in the file browser, and double-click the file to add it to the converter. Click the file name in the main conversion window to select the file.

    • 3). Click the "To DVD" tab at the bottom of the control panel. Click the "Preset" menu, and choose "Motion menu," "Thumbnail menu" or "Text menu" from the drop-down list. Click "DVD size" menu, and choose "Double-layer DVD" if your AVI file is much larger than 4.7 GB.

    • 4). Insert a blank DVD, and click "Burn."

    AVS Video Converter 6

    • 1). Download and install the DVD creation tool from AVS. Click the "Start" menu and "AVS4YOU" to launch the software.

    • 2). Click "Input File" to search your computer for AVI video. Double-click the file you want to convert, and click "To DVD" in the toolbar at the top of the window.

    • 3). Click "Profile," and choose "Long Play" if your AVI video lasts longer than four hours. Choose "High Quality" if your video only runs for 60 minutes, or choose "Good Quality" if it runs for 90 minutes. Click "Convert Now."

    • 4). Insert a blank DVD when the AVI conversion finishes. Click "Burn Disc."

    AVI Compression Freeware

    • 1). Download and install Free Video Converter from Koyote. Double-click the desktop icon to launch the converter.

    • 2). Click "Add Files" in the upper left corner of the window. Find your AVI file in the hard drive browser, and double-click the file to load it in the converter. Click "Output Format" at the bottom of the window.

    • 3). Click "DVD NTSC Format" in the selection window. Click "Convert Video" to compress the AVI for disc-burning.

    • 4). Insert a blank DVD. Run your DVD-burning software, and click "Video DVD." Click "Add," and locate your converted DVD video file on your computer desktop. Alternately, drag the file from your desktop to the disc-burning window. Click "Burn."
